Thomas `Mossy' McGrane, Dublin's left half forward, scored a total of 1-10 as Dublin's under21 hurlers demolished holders Wexford in the second half of this extraordinary Leinster semi-final at Dr Cullen Park, Carlow, last evening.

An assured Wexford side took control of the first half and Chris McGrath's 15th-minute goal provided the platform for Wexford's substantial 1-9 to 0-4 interval lead. The Dubs seemed dead and buried. Remarkably, within 12 minutes of the restart they were level and although they were level again with 13 minutes remaining, Dublin's superior fitness proved the key factor.
